About this property
Secluded family-friendly lake house in the woods
Bring family and friends together in this hidden waterfront home with a rustic log cabin feel, nestled into seven acres of woods!
Feel the stress leave your body as you enter this serene property, surrounded by wildlife. We regularly see hawks, herons, swans, owls, sand hill cranes, foxes, beavers and deer.
Roast s'mores over a fire pit that overlooks the water!
Take a kayak out to visit the beaver habitat on the other side of the lake!
Leap high into the sky on our trampoline, then challenge your kids or friends to a fun game of foosball!
The house features a full kitchen with two refrigerators, two dishwashers, and everything you'll need to prepare a feast for your friends and family. A well-equipped office space allows guests to plug in to a monitor, keyboard and mouse. The large, third-floor loft offers a slumber party vibe for the kids, and a dog run traverses the backyard so Fido can to join in the fun!
About the house:
DOWNSTAIRS: Enter through the den where our comfy leather reclining chairs and sofas double as charging stations for your devices, then head through the fully-equipped kitchen, which has all the tools you'll need to prepare a feast including a slow-cooker, a blender and an espresso machine. The attached dining area features ample seating including a large dining table, a smaller table (perfect for jigsaw puzzles) and a pair of lounge chairs overlooking the lake.
UNPLUG and UNWIND: This house has no TV but it has decent free wifi so bring any screens you'll need with you.
THE DECKS: The back deck features an outdoor dining table, two folding chaise chairs that can be brought to the fire pit, a swinging hammock chair and a gas grill. The fire deck has a fire pit and a pair of inviting Adirondack chairs looking out over the lake. It's perfect for yoga! A hammock hangs nearby.
THE BOAT DOCK: Sit on the waterside bench, or take one of our kayaks out to the inflatable swim island. Note: Our lake fills with lily pads in the summer but the kayaks glide over them to reach the swim island. We have four kid-sized life jackets, two adult life jacket sizes (M and XL) and a toddler life jacket. Three single kayaks are available near the lake. Two large inflatable double kayaks are also available by request.
OFFICE: Need to stay connected with the office? Plug in to a monitor, keyboard, mouse and laptop on a sit/stand desk overlooking the front porch. (Another smaller desk is in Bedroom 1 upstairs if two people need a quiet place to work). This room has a futon (but this isn't an ideal sleeping area since the nearest bathroom is upstairs).
UPSTAIRS: You'll find the foosball table in the common area, a cozy reading nook with a light and a curtain that can close to create a private oasis, a LEGO nook with lots of LEGOs, a crafting nook and a washer/dryer. Note: The floor sofa from the reading nook can migrate up to the loft to sleep more kids up there!
NOTE: All of our bathrooms are on the second floor so this house is not ideal for people with limited mobility. Keep an eye on small children. The house has not been child-proofed.
BEDROOM 1 features a queen bed, a dresser, a lending library (take a book, leave a book), a walk-in closet, a working area with a desk chair, and a private bathroom with a shower. The twin bed in this room can be great for parents traveling with a child. Don't like this configuration? This twin bed has legs that fold up so it can move to another room or up into the loft.
BEDROOM 2 has two twin beds, a closet, a dresser and a view of the lake. It sits beside a newly renovated bathroom with a tub and shower.
BEDROOM 3 has big windows with glorious views of the lake, a king bed, a closet, two dressers and a newly renovated private bathroom with a big tub and a shower (note: due to the slope of the ceiling in this bathroom, there's no shower curtain so don't worry if things get a little wet). This room has a large entryway with a futon where a child can sleep. Or, the futon can be moved elsewhere. such as up to the loft This room and bathroom were built separately from the rest of the house so are not connected to the main heating and cooling system. Use the floorboard heaters in the winter. Use the a/c unit in the bedroom on hot days, or open the windows, turn on the ceiling fan and fall asleep to the sounds of nature!
THE THIRD-FLOOR LOFT is the ultimate kid hideout and retreat that runs the length of the house! (Adults can sleep here too but sloped ceilings mean they'll have to walk down the middle of the room). The spacious loft has lots of light, two twin beds, a small storage unit for clothes and a bean bag chair. Three additional beds/futons can be added -- the twin from bedroom 1, the floor sofa from the second-floor reading nook and the futon from the entry to bedroom 3 will turn the loft into a fun slumber party! Kids will find more LEGOs and K'nex to play with as well as a K'nex ferris wheel.
